Biography
I am a research-led mixed media artist, curious about the psychology of touch and play. This curiosity has guided my interest in creating tactile objects for the benefit of the user, whether that is visual, mental or physical. Visuotactility is the main drive for my designs; exploring with my hands is equally as important as exploring with my eyes. Living alongside nature, in the Cotswolds, Devon and Cornwall, has inspired me to use tactile natural forms as starting points within my work.
I focus my creative practice largely on casting techniques, working with various materials, such as glass, fine metals and rubbers to transform artefacts into objects with unexpected qualities. Having some experience with jewellery-making I have combined these skills together to create a collection of playful jewellery.
